2016 Football

9 Ke'Desh Edwards

  • Height 6-3
  • Weight 210
  • Year Senior
  • Hometown Greensboro, N.C.
  • High School Western Guilford
  • Position DB
  • Major Sport Management

Biography

Career

  • appeared in 35 games and tallied five total tackles on defense and special teams
  • spent his first two seasons splitting time at wide receiver, where he recorded 14 catches for 234 yards with one touchdown
  • recorded 10 blocks on special teams, a school record

2016

  • Named Guilford's Most Valuable Player
  • played in all 10 games almost exclusively on special teams
  • blocked two kicks, raising his career total to a school-record 10

2015

  • appeared in 10 games as a reserve receiver and on special teams
  • led the team for the third straight year in blocked kicks

2014

  • played in seven games for the Quakers as a reserve receiver and on special teams
  • had seven receptions for a total of 51 yards including his first collegiate touchdown catch, which came in a win over Methodist
  • one of his best performances came at Randolph-Macon when he had two catches for a total of 24 yards and also blocked an extra point
  • played on special teams and blocked three extra-point attempts  

2013

  • played in nine games as a reserve receiver
  • recorded seven receptions on the year of 183 yards
  • longest reception was 53 yards against Shenandoah College
  • a top performance came at Methodist with four catches for 62 yards
  • blocked a school-record three kicks at Catholic University, which earned him a spot on D3football.com’s Team of the Week

Personal                                                                              

  • two-time member of Guilford's Student-Athlete Honor Roll
  • member of Guilford's Brothers Doing Positive club
  • mentors students at a local elementary school
  • four-year letter winner at nearby Western Guilford High School under coach Chris Causey
  • three-time All-Metro 4A Conference honoree
  • two-year basketball letter winner
  • standout sprinter for the Hornets’ track and field team
  • son of Shawn Edwards
